About Spendor

Spendor, a quintessential British hi-fi brand, traces its origins to the late 1960s when BBC sound engineer Spencer Hughes and his wife Dorothy founded the company in Sussex, England—the name itself a clever fusion of "Spen" and "Dor." Drawing on Spencer's expertise alongside co-designer Dudley Harwood, they pioneered the BC1 loudspeaker in 1969, featuring the world's first commercial 8-inch plastic cone driver made from innovative Bextrene material. This breakthrough quickly established Spendor as the monitor of choice for broadcasters, recording studios, and discerning listeners worldwide, setting a benchmark for transparent, natural sound.

The brand focuses exclusively on loudspeakers, designing, engineering, and hand-building every driver, crossover, and cabinet in their Sussex facility. Their lineup spans the accessible A series for mainstream buyers, the premium D series for high-end performance, and the Classic line, which revives iconic designs like the BC1 with modern polymer and Kevlar cones, cast-magnesium chassis, and advanced motor systems. Spendor eschews amplifiers, turntables, or headphones, prioritizing pure speaker innovation rooted in BBC-honed precision.

Today, under owner Philip Swift since 2000, Spendor holds a revered position as a high-end, heritage British marque, blending vintage collector appeal with contemporary excellence. Renowned among audiophiles and professionals for smooth, low-distortion imaging and musicality, it remains a global reference standard, entirely made in the UK to captivate serious hi-fi enthusiasts.
